Alden B. Dow (1904–1983) was a visionary architect whose work blended modernist innovation with a deep respect for natural surroundings. He cultivated a design philosophy that emphasized harmony between people, buildings, and the landscape, leaving an indelible mark across the Midwest.
Dow’s creations brought warmth, light, and balance to civic and private spaces alike, and his influence endures in the countless structures that continue to inspire admiration. His commitment to thoughtful craftsmanship and experimentation remains a guiding light for architects today.
